Have Hunches, Make Sales – Turn a Hunch into a Customer

Following instincts provides benefits for a number of reasons. It can help a person survive a dangerous situation, or uncover something important. Part of instinct is intuition and hunches are the manifestation of intuition. Even in sales a hunches and intuition can be a valuable asset. Hunches are not always accurate but by following them, however each one provides a variety of experiences, whether it is a sale, or just new knowledge. It also can help to teach which hunches to follow and which can be ignored or left for later. Gaining the skill to follow hunches can help to increase sales by providing a way to know when the time might be ripe to contact a previous customer. In this manner, it can be used as a constructive and creative idea to boost potential sales.

Knowing when you get a hunch and what to do

The first thing to knowing when a hunch is present is to be alert and know the feeling that comes with this intuition. The next step is to act promptly. Instinct is both a natural and a learned process. The first kind goes to things that are ingrained, survival is one of those, and the second kind is learned. This instinct comes from knowledge and experience.

By following hunches experience is gained and the salesperson gains a feel for the situations that cause them to be present. For example, experience may tell a sales person that the customer they are currently speaking with is not quite ready to make a sale but may be within the next week. This thought is instinct born from experience and it remains in the back of the sales persons mind. A week later that sales person gets a feeling or hunch that it would be a good time to contact that potential. They do so and a sale is made.

What is a hunch?

A hunch is a strong sense or pull to do something or it could be an idea that pops into the sales person's head telling them to contact someone or do something. Many people believe that hunches are spiritual in nature and there is nothing to state that a hunch is not somehow spiritually connected.

However, the brain like God works in mysterious ways. It can process information at incredible rates and stores everything heard, seen and experienced. With the right frame of mind, one that is one to hunches. The mind can produce the result to a set of criteria at the time it is needed even if it is a month, a year or ten years from the time of the initial information gathering.

No matter what the belief if a hunch is scientific or spiritual or even both the fact remains that hunches can and do help to increase sales from salespeople who take the time to listen to these pulls and follow what they are being directed by it to do.

The important thing is learning how to notice that a hunch is there and learning how to listen more closely to what is being said. This helps to ensure a higher success rate. Things like meditation and keeping the mind clear of cluttering thoughts can provide assistance in knowing when a hunch is there and knowing when to act on that hunch.
